Aayiram Kaal = 1000 pillar
The thousand-pillared hall built during the late Vijayanagara period.[4] Krishnadevaraya constructed the hall and dug the tank opposite to it. The pillars in the hall are carved with images of yali, a mythological beast with body of lion and head of an elephant, a symbol of Nayak power.
Archaeological Survey of India declared the temple a national heritage monument and took over its stewardship
